K&L Gates loses legal-services contract with Microsoft

K&L Gates has lost its status as one of Microsoft's preferred legal providers. K&L Gates, which was the product of a merger between international law firm Kirkpatrick & Lockhart and Seattle-based Preston Gates & Ellis, was not among the ten law firms selected by Microsoft. The software company had solicited bids for its preferred-provider program in January. Microsoft was one of Preston Gates' most important clients and played a major role defending Microsoft during the U.S. antitrust case.
